| - | [ | + | [https://www.uniprot.org/uniprot/GALE_BIFL2 GALE_BIFL2] Involved in the metabolism of galactose. Catalyzes the conversion of UDP-galactose (UDP-Gal) to UDP-glucose (UDP-Glc) through a mechanism involving the transient reduction of NAD. Can also epimerize UDP-GalNAc to UDP-GlcNAc. Involved in the lacto-N-biose I/galacto-N-biose (LNB/GNB) degradation pathway, which is important for host intestinal colonization by bifidobacteria.<ref>PMID:17720833</ref> |
